what are the price points for the 3.7 and vv?

3.7 costs $110
VV costs $160

Both can be custom ordered or you can buy one of the general sale ones (usually 3.7v) when he puts them up for sale. He only takes about 15 custom orders after the current batch has been sold.

Here's the rough requesting process...
After the above batch is sold I will start taking requests for mods. When a request is made it will be logged down and you will be able to choose...
1. Type of wood for body
2. Type of wood for caps and inlay
3. 3.7v using 18650 batt and 6ml bottle $110 OR VV using 18350 batts and 6ml bottle $160
4. Gloss or Matte Arm-R-Seal finish (best protection), Tung Oil finish, Danish Oil finish, Boiled Linseed Oil finish, or Teak Oil finish
5. Choice of LED bottle illumination. Choices are White, Blue, Red, Purple, Green, Yellow, and No LED

When a request for a mod is made It will go into a journal of mods to make in what order and I will do my best to get it made in a timely fashion. Understand that the list might get long and "Timely" might mean it might take quite a bit of time.
When the requested mod is finished I will contact the person that has requested the Mod and they will have 3 days to Pay for the mod so that it can be shipped. If payment is not made within those 3 days the Mod will be offered up to first come, first serve on the forum.
I will try to keep the mods coming out in order of of requests but please understand that if I have wood on hand to finish someones mod request that was placed after yours but I'm still waiting on your wood to ship, theirs will most likely be done first.
I will post a list of wood I currently have access to locally before I start taking requests. If the wood you desire is difficult to obtain or quite a bit more costly than the exotics I have available locally, the cost of your mod might slightly increase in price or require a deposit to obtain your wood. This will be discussed with you after your request has been made and I can locate your desired wood.
